Output 61e76bf5efbbf67295da9abfec657bc699ea180347e7c7054b06452fd9b937da:0

value
745931419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8c0265f7ccba34adaf30357c12ee79bf50374a OP_EQUAL
address
MTpjGGepbjvJd5PGJHoivfY2Cy1wBaxTAg
transaction
61e76bf5efbbf67295da9abfec657bc699ea180347e7c7054b06452fd9b937da
spent
true